Symptoms

  • •Check engine light illuminated
  • •Power locks malfunctioning
  • •Interior lights flickering
  • •Difficulty starting the engine
  • •Unresponsive dashboard indicators
  • •Battery drains quickly

Solution
1. Preparation
  • Tools Required: OBD-II scanner, multimeter, socket set, wire strippers, electrical tape, and replacement fuses.
  • Disconnect the battery negative terminal to ensure safety while working on the electrical system.
2. Battery Inspection and Testing
  • Sub-steps:
    1. Remove the battery cover, if applicable, and disconnect the positive terminal followed by the negative terminal.
    2. Use a multimeter to check the battery voltage. Replace if the voltage is below 12.4 volts.
    3. Clean the battery terminals and connectors using a wire brush to remove corrosion.
    4. Reconnect the terminals, starting with the positive terminal first.
3. Fuse Replacement
  • Sub-steps:
    1. Locate the fuse box, which is usually found under the dashboard or in the engine compartment.
    2. Use a fuse puller or pliers to carefully remove any blown fuses.
    3. Replace with new fuses of the same amperage rating.
    4. Ensure that the fuse box cover is securely replaced.
4. Ground Connection Repair
  • Sub-steps:
    1. Identify all ground points, especially those near the battery and engine.
    2. Remove the ground connections and clean the contact surfaces with sandpaper to ensure a good connection.
    3. Reinstall ground connections securely and apply dielectric grease to prevent future corrosion.
5. Wiring Repairs
  • Sub-steps:
    1. Carefully inspect wiring harnesses for visible damage.
    2. Use wire strippers to remove damaged sections and splice in new wire of the same gauge.
    3. Insulate splices with electrical tape or heat-shrink tubing.
    4. Secure the wiring harness with zip ties to avoid movement and further wear.
